The year was 1981 and the band known as the Butthole Surfers had just signed to Jello Biafra's "Alternative Tentacles" label. After 2 unaccounted years the band released their first studio album entitled "A Brown Reason to Live".

When first released the album featured no title but only a sticker that said "Pee Pee the Sailor" The album also made no mention of which band members performed on which songs, where and when it was recorded and who produced it..

1. Shah Sleeps In Lee Harvey's Grave ~ 2:09
"There's a time to f'uck and a time to crave but the Shah sleeps in Lee Harvey's grave". One of the weirdest songs on the entire album. It features someone maybe Gibby and a wall of noise and feedback. The song ends off perfectly with the sound of a man weeping and yelling.

2. Hey ~ 2:05
This song is one of the more punk influenced songs on the album. It kicks off with a nice catchy bassline and Gibby repeating the word "Hey" with echo effect. It's a very catchy song but it's way to short.

3. Something ~ 4:37
Another punkier song which starts off with the drums playing by itself and then followed by the guitar and bass. The song also features Gibby screechy singing and yelling.

4. BBQ Pope ~ 3:34
Another song with screechy vocals and hilarious lyrics. This song is sort of the same as the previous track except with a bitchin guitar solo!

5. Wichita Cathedral ~ ?:?? Wichita Cathedral
Another song with a fantastic catchy bassline and great drums. Gibby's voice on the song is absolutely beautiful. When I first heard the song I thought it wasn't a Butthole Surfers song. This song has got to be the high point of the entire album

6. Suicide ~
This song has Gibby pretended to be a suicidal teenager. The opening lyrics on the song are rather hilarious. This song really shows the bands punk influences.

7. Revenge Of Anus Presley ~
This song sounds a lot like the first song. The guitar and bass have a real sludgy sound that fits perfectly with the vocals and random noises.

An amazing punk/noise rock album. It was overlooked by the the mainstream and found a cult like following. Most people would think this album as a bunch of noise but others see it as a masterpiece.
